Shimano Grand Tour challenge goes live on Strava

In honour of the 3 grand tours, SHIMANO is challenging you to ride 333km or more during in the next 3 weeks.

The grand tours of professional cycling are highly anticipated fixtures of the summer months, serving as inspiration to get out and ride more. But with 2020’s grand tours shifted to the Autumn, you surely still need your fix of summer cycling, so let the SHIMANO Grand Tour inspire you!

In honour of the 3 grand tours, SHIMANO is challenging you to ride 333km or more between Tuesday 21st July and Monday 10th August.

If you complete the challenge you stand a chance of winning exactly the same equipment that the pro’s use: SHIMANO’s top of the range DURA-ACE Di2 groupset (disc or rim brake) with a R9100-P power meter!

Oh… and if you think riding 333km sounds easy then, for those riding 21 days in a row (2 rest days allowed), just like the pro’s, SHIMANO will have some special prizes up for grabs!

What’s more, to inspire riders across Europe in the challenge, SHIMANO’s neutral service team will be at three popular cycling locations in Europe to offer support, advice and mechanical maintenance (although unfortunately no sticky bottles).

Shimano Neutral Support cars will be present at the following locations:

  • Netherlands: Thursday 23 July at Amerongse berg (parking bay on top)
  • Spain: Thursday 06 August Madrid region
  • Italy: Sunday 02 August, Siena region

Exact timings and locations will be communicated via Shimano Facebook pages in Netherlands, Spain and Italy.

To enter, head over to the Strava Challenges page and enroll in the SHIMANO GRAND TOUR challenge. Winners will be contacted by email from Monday 10th August onwards.
